Economic and Social Survey of Asia and the Pacific 2010


Author(s): Macroeconomic Policy and Development Division (MPDD)
Economic Sector(s): (1) Global, regional and multisectoral economic and social development strategies and policies
ESCAP Reference No.: ST/ESCAP/2547
Division/Office: Macroeconomic Policy and Development
Published Date: April 2010
Country: {Non-country Specific Publication}
Hard Copy Price: N/A


>>>> Link to Survey 2010 website <<<<<

This year’s Survey, entitled “Sustaining Recovery and Dynamism for Inclusive Development ” assesses the critical issues, policy challenges and risks that the region faces in the months ahead as it leads the world economy in recovery from a dire recession. It also outlines the elements of a policy agenda for regaining the region’s dynamism through inclusive and sustainable growth
